To find the gene that encodes for the blue-light receptor, researchers inserted the gene for the PHOT1 protein into insect cells growing in culture

When they exposed the transgenic cells to blue light, they found that the PHOT1 protein became phosphorylated. No other plant proteins were present in the insect cells. Which of the following is a reasonable conclusion from this result? The PHOT1 protein _____.
A) enabled the insect cells to photosynthesize
B) phosphorylated itself in the presence of blue light
C) is not responsive to blue light
D) is photoreversible
E) is not functional in insect cells


Answer: B
